titleOfInvention |
Hybridoma cell strain XA272-917, antibody and application of antibody |
abstract |
The invention relates to a hybridoma cell strain XA272-917, an antibody and an application of the antibody. The involved hybridoma cell strain is characterized by having a collection number of CCTCC NO:C2016113. The involved antibody is an antibody secreted by the hybridoma cell strain. The involved application is an application of the antibody to the detection of human CTRP9A and an application of the antibody to the preparation of a human CTRP9A detection kit. |
